Web15 aug. 2024 · If an atom, or atoms, possessed a balanced number of electrons (negative charge) and protons (positive charge) they are neutral overall. However, if they are none balanced, they will be charged. These charged species are called ions. WebFinding ionic charges for elements on the Periodic Table is a fundamental skill in chemistry.
